UK Political Developments

Across the Atlantic, the United Kingdom also experienced significant political shifts in 1988. One notable event was the merger in March of the SDP and the Liberals, which led to the formation of the Liberal Democrats. This move, in a way, reshaped the political landscape there, creating a new force in British politics. It was, you know, a moment of realignment for those parties, and it showed how political alliances can change over time. These kinds of developments, basically, affect the direction of a country.

The Piper Alpha Oil Rig Explosion

Another significant disaster in 1988, particularly in the United Kingdom, was the Piper Alpha oil rig explosion. This tragic incident, you know, resulted in a substantial loss of life and was a major industrial catastrophe. It brought attention to safety regulations and the dangers inherent in certain industries. The Piper Alpha event, in a way, stands as a stark reminder of the risks involved in extracting resources. It's a moment that, basically, led to many discussions about industrial safety practices.
